This collection presents two important Old French heroic poems, 'Aiol et Mirabel' and 'Elie de Saint Gille', edited by Wendelin Foerster. These works exemplify the chanson de geste tradition, offering invaluable insights into medieval French literature, language, and culture. 'Aiol et Mirabel' tells the story of Aiol, a young knight, and his adventures, while 'Elie de Saint Gille' recounts the heroic deeds of Elie.
